The dining room is classy but in an understated way. A curvaceous bar faces a light-hued dining area, with an elevated lounge area and a view out to the patio and, beyond, the Art Museum and Lake Michigan. The place has the feel of a old-time upscale hotel dining room and bar. But if the vibe is old-style, the food feels up to the minute.
The food celebrates the coasts of the United States, so expect seafood and dishes based on Hawaiian, California, cajun and other regional cuisines.
